UPD784026 Renesas Electronics Corporation., UPD784026 Datasheet - Page 455
UPD784026
Manufacturer Part Number
UPD784026
Description
16/8-bit Single-chip Microcontrollers
Manufacturer
Renesas Electronics Corporation.
Datasheet
1.UPD784026.pdf
(759 pages)
- Current page: 455 of 759
- Download datasheet (3Mb)
16.3 3-WIRE SERIAL I/O MODE
input (SI). Handshaking lines are required when a number of devices are connected.
16.3.1 Configuration in 3-Wire Serial I/O Mode
Cautions 1. The contents of the asynchronous serial interface status register (ASIS) are cleared (0) by reading
The 3-wire serial I/O mode is used to communicate with devices that incorporate a conventional clocked serial interface.
Basically, communication is performed using three lines: the serial clock (SCK), serial data output (SO), and serial data
* Handshaking lines
The block diagram in the 3-wire serial I/O mode is shown in Figure 16-10.
3-wire serial I/O
2. The RXB must be read even if there is a receive error. If RXB is not read, an overrun error will
3. To disable the reception completion interrupt when a reception error occurs, make sure that wait
the receive buffer (RXB) or by reception of the next data. If you want to find the details of an error,
therefore, ASIS must be read before reading RXB.
occur when the next data is received, and the receive error state will continue indefinitely.
time equivalent to two pulses of the clock that serves as the reference of the baud rate clock elapse
after the reception error occurs until the receive buffers (RXB, RXB2) are read. If the wait time
is not inserted, the reception completion interrupt occurs even when it is disabled.
The wait time equivalent to two pulses of the clock that serves as the reference of the baud rate
clock can be calculated by the following expression:
Wait time =
Remark f
CHAPTER 16 ASYNCHRONOUS SERIAL INTERFACE/3-WIRE SERIAL I/O
Figure 16-9 Example of 3-Wire Serial I/O System Configuration
3-wire serial I/O
n : Value of baud rate generator control registers (BRGC, BRGC2) to select tap of 12-bit
XX
: Oscillation frequency
2
Master CPU
f
n+3
XX
prescaler (n = 0 to 11)
Port (Interrupt)
SCK
Port
SO
SI
*
SCK
SI
SO
Port
Interrupt (Port)
Slave CPU
415
Related parts for UPD784026
Image
Part Number
Description
Manufacturer
Datasheet
Request
R
Part Number:
Description:
Renesas Technology Corp [Renesas 32-Bit RISC Microcomputer Super RISC engine Family/SH7700 Series]
Manufacturer:
Renesas Electronics Corporation.
Datasheet:
Part Number:
Description:
RENESAS MCU M16C FAMILY / M16C/Tiny SERIES
Manufacturer:
Renesas Electronics Corporation.
Datasheet:
Part Number:
Description:
Renesas Starter Kit for RX210
Manufacturer:
Renesas Electronics Corporation.
Part Number:
Description:
EVALBOARD/Renesas StarterKit for RX630
Manufacturer:
Renesas Electronics Corporation.
Part Number:
Description:
EVALBOARD/Renesas Starter Kit+ for RX63N
Manufacturer:
Renesas Electronics Corporation.
Part Number:
Description:
EVALBOARD/Renesas Starter Kit
Manufacturer:
Renesas Electronics Corporation.
Part Number:
Description:
FLASH PROGRAMMER FOR RENESAS MICROCONTROLLERS
Manufacturer:
Renesas Electronics Corporation.
Part Number:
Description:
Manufacturer:
Renesas Electronics Corporation.
Datasheet:
Part Number:
Description:
Manufacturer:
Renesas Electronics Corporation.
Datasheet:
Part Number:
Description:
Manufacturer:
Renesas Electronics Corporation.
Datasheet:
Part Number:
Description:
Manufacturer:
Renesas Electronics Corporation.
Datasheet:
Part Number:
Description:
Manufacturer:
Renesas Electronics Corporation.
Datasheet:
Part Number:
Description:
Manufacturer:
Renesas Electronics Corporation.
Datasheet:
Part Number:
Description:
Manufacturer:
Renesas Electronics Corporation.
Datasheet:
Part Number:
Description:
Manufacturer:
Renesas Electronics Corporation.
Datasheet: